One Dead, 17 Injured in Eluru Bus-Lorry Collision
A bus traveling from Hyderabad to Vizianagaram hit a lorry that was parked on the road.
The crash happened early Saturday near Yandapalli.
One person, the bus cleaner, died at the scene.
Seventeen people were hurt.
Some injured passengers were taken to a hospital in Chintalapudi.
Five others were taken to a hospital in Sathupalli.
Many of the passengers were IT employees traveling home for a long weekend and Ganesh Chaturthi.
Police are investigating what happened.
